These D100's are HUGE - 45mm and much easier to read than it seems. The roll is the number on the flat side facing straight up and once you see it, you'll be able to easily find the number each time.
A 100 sided die, or D100, invented by Lou Zocci in 1985 is sometimes called Zocchihedron or "Zocchi's Golfball". Rather than being a polyhedron, it is more like a ball with 100 flattened planes and is designed to handle percentage rolls in games, particularly in role-playing games.
